English meaning
- payback noun Revenge for something someone has done.
- retribution noun Punishment given out of a sense of justice or revenge for a wrong that was done.
- revanche noun Revenge or retaliation.
- revenge noun Harm done to someone in return for a wrong they committed against you.
- vendetta noun A long-running, bitter feud driven by a desire for revenge, often passed down between families or groups.
- vengeance noun Punishment inflicted in return for a wrong or injury; revenge.
